Swirled Christmas Cookies

Swirled Christmas Cookies That Bring Holiday Cheer to Your Table

Enjoy the magic of festive baking with these Swirled Christmas Cookies, perfect for sharing during the holiday season.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 14 minutes
Chilling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 14 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 80

Ingredients
  

For the Dough
  • 1 cup Unsalted Butter at room temperature
  • 1 cup Granulated Sugar can replace with brown sugar
  • 1 Large Egg substitute with flax egg for vegan option
  • 1 teaspoon Almond Extract or v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Bean Paste/Extract or vanilla essence
  • 2.5 cups All-Purpose Flour or gluten-free flour blend
  • 2 tablespoons Cornstarch omit if in a pinch
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Powder ensure freshness
  • 0.5 teaspoon Fine Salt omit if using salted butter
For Decoration
  • 1 cup Christmas Sprinkles colored sugar or nuts can substitute
  • as needed Gel Food Coloring liquid coloring may alter dough consistency

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• Electric Mixer
  • Baking Sheets
  • Plastic Wrap
  • Wire Rack

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Swirled Christmas Cookies
  1. Cream butter and sugar together until light and fluffy.
  2. Mix in egg and extracts until fully incorporated.
  3. Combine dry ingredients and mix into wet until just combined.
  4. Divide dough and color with gel food coloring.
  5. Chill dough wrapped in plastic wrap for at least 30 minutes.
  6.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and roll out dough.
  7. Stack colored dough and roll into a log.
  8. Coat log in Christmas sprinkles.
  9. Slice dough log into 1/3-inch thick slices.
  10. Bake for 12-14 minutes until edges are golden.
  11. Cool on baking sheets for 15 minutes before transferring to wire rack.

Notes

Use room temperature butter for best results and avoid overflattening the dough.
